引言
随着科技的发展,大数据和人工智能技术逐渐成为各个领域的热门话题。大模型设计作为人工智能领域的一个重要分支,其复杂性和实用性日益凸显。为了帮助读者更好地理解和掌握大模型设计,本文将结合一张图和视频教程,详细解析大模型设计的关键步骤和技巧。
一、大模型设计概述
大模型设计是指构建一个能够处理大规模数据、具有高度智能和自主学习能力的模型。它通常包括以下几个核心组成部分:
- 数据预处理:对原始数据进行清洗、转换和格式化,使其适合模型训练。
- 特征提取:从数据中提取有用的特征,用于模型学习和决策。
- 模型架构设计:选择合适的模型架构,如神经网络、决策树等。
- 模型训练与优化:使用训练数据对模型进行训练,并通过优化算法提高模型性能。
- 模型评估与部署:评估模型性能,并将其部署到实际应用场景中。
二、一图看懂大模型设计
以下是一张展示大模型设计流程的图,通过这张图,您可以快速了解大模型设计的整体架构和步骤。
graph LR A[数据预处理] --> B{特征提取} B --> C[模型架构设计] C --> D[模型训练与优化] D --> E{模型评估} E --> F[模型部署]
三、视频教程解析
为了更直观地了解大模型设计,以下是一个简短的视频教程,详细介绍了大模型设计的各个步骤。
视频教程步骤:
- 数据预处理:介绍数据清洗、转换和格式化的方法,以及常用的数据预处理工具。
- 特征提取:讲解特征提取的重要性,以及如何从数据中提取有用特征。
- 模型架构设计:介绍常见的模型架构,如神经网络、决策树等,并分析其优缺点。
- 模型训练与优化:讲解模型训练的基本原理,以及如何使用优化算法提高模型性能。
- 模型评估与部署:介绍模型评估指标和方法,以及如何将模型部署到实际应用场景中。
视频教程示例代码:
# 假设使用Python进行数据预处理
import pandas as pd
# 读取数据
data = pd.read_csv("data.csv")
# 数据清洗
data = data.dropna() # 删除缺失值
data = data[data["column"] > 0] # 过滤掉不符合条件的行
# 数据转换
data["column"] = data["column"].astype(float) # 转换数据类型
四、总结
大模型设计是一个复杂而重要的过程,需要综合考虑数据、算法、架构等多个方面。通过本文的介绍和视频教程,相信读者已经对大模型设计有了初步的了解。在实际应用中,不断学习和实践是提高大模型设计能力的关键。